In his powerful fifth collection, John Leonard dissects contemporary life and ideas in intense, but human, lyric poetry. This four - part collection begins with a section of meditative poems of everyday moments, often of great peace ('the Hope and Trust of the Times'). Following a section of satires on the complacencies and delusions of our world, a section on poetry and other arts reinstates a feeling of the grounded and the valid ('Sadness is no Longer Sad'). The final section, ('Change beyond Change'), is a series of reflections on the end - game our society is playing with the global environment, and necessarily ends on a sombre note.
